WebHow many heart does a snail have? A snail's heart has two chambers, one ventricle and one atrium. It is located in the heart bag, the so-called pericardium. Web19 Aug 2024 · Snails usually have two heart chambers, one atrium and one ventricle. Few groups have two atriums, making the heart a three-chambered one. The blood of a snail is pumped through the body in two loops. free little league rule bookWebA slug or snail moves by rhythmic waves of muscular contraction on the underside of its foot. At the same time a layer of mucus is secreted, which helps smooth the slug’s path across the ground. Slugs and snails have two pairs of retractable tentacles on their head.
